Material : jade
Origin : Olmec
Culture : Mexico
Era : ca 1000/ 800 BC
Condition : intact
Dimensions : 1-5/8'' H
Rare carved light creamy green stone pendant, depicting a stylized human head having a wide nose, toothy grin, corners of the mouth drilled, segmented hairdo and narrow eyes. Perforations at the temples and under the chin for attachement. Drilled concentric ring pattern on the reverse side. Intact.
Provenance: ex. private Florida collection, 1960.
